CloudConvert features and specs

  • Versatility
    CloudConvert supports a wide range of file formats for conversion, including documents, images, videos, audio, eBooks, and more. This makes it a one-stop solution for most conversion needs.
  • User-Friendly Interface
    The platform has an intuitive and easy-to-use interface, making it accessible for users of all levels of technical expertise.
  • Cloud Integration
    CloudConvert allows for integration with various cloud storage services such as Google Drive, Dropbox, and OneDrive, making it easy to convert files stored in the cloud.
  • API Access
    CloudConvert offers a powerful API, which is beneficial for developers who need to integrate file conversion capabilities into their applications.
  • High-Quality Conversions
    The service ensures that the quality of the converted files remains high and consistent, which is crucial for professional use.
  • No Installation Required
    As a web-based application, CloudConvert does not require any software installation, which saves storage space and system resources.

Possible disadvantages of CloudConvert

  • Limited Free Usage
    The free version of CloudConvert comes with limitations on the number of conversions and file size, which may not be sufficient for heavy users.
  • Internet Dependency
    Being a cloud service, Internet connectivity is required to use CloudConvert, making it less useful in offline scenarios.
  • Privacy Concerns
    Uploading files to a cloud-based service raises potential privacy and security concerns, especially for sensitive or confidential information.
  • Performance Variability
    The speed and performance of file conversions may vary depending on server load and internet connection quality.
  • Subscription Costs
    While the service offers a free tier, advanced features and higher usage limits require a paid subscription, which might be costly for some users.

R Markdown features and specs

  • Reproducibility
    R Markdown allows users to embed R code within a document, ensuring that analyses are reproducible. Changes to data or code will automatically update outputs in the document.
  • Interactivity
    Users can create interactive documents using Shiny components, enabling dynamic exploration and presentation of data directly from an R Markdown file.
  • Versatility
    R Markdown supports multiple output formats, including HTML, PDF, Word, and slides, making it versatile for different reporting needs.
  • Integration
    Seamlessly integrates with R and the RStudio IDE, allowing easy code execution, visualization, and document creation in a single environment.
  • Customization
    Supports extensive customization with themes, templates, and support for LaTeX, ensuring documents fit specific stylistic and formatting requirements.

Possible disadvantages of R Markdown

  • Learning Curve
    Beginners may find it challenging to learn R Markdown due to the need to understand both Markdown syntax and R code integration.
  • Complexity with Large Projects
    Managing large projects can become complex, especially when integrating multiple datasets, scripts, and output types.
  • Performance Limitations
    Rendering large documents with extensive computations can be slow and may require substantial computational resources.
  • Limited Native Support
    R Markdown's native support for certain advanced features is limited, and additional packages or configurations may be necessary.
  • Dependency Management
    Ensuring all required packages and their versions are correctly installed and managed across different environments can be challenging.

  • Reinventing notebooks as reusable Python programs
    I am surprised they didn't mention RMarkdown (https://rmarkdown.rstudio.com/), which was developed in parallel to Jupyter Notebooks, with lots of convergent evolution. RMarkdown is essentially Markdown with executable code blocks. While it comes from an R background, code blocks can be written in any language (and you can mix multiple languages). The biggest difference (and, I would say, advantage) is that it... - Source: Hacker News / over 1 year ago
